Need for Information

• Access to suitable cancer information is consistently shown to be one of the main priorities for patients and carers.

• Information about cancer is also part of a much wider remit which needs to include health promotion, raising awareness of cancer risks, survivorship and living with cancer.

Background

• Macmillan Cancer Information and Support Bus visited MCCN this year for 13 days going to:

• Jaguar Car Factory, Liverpool City centre, Chester, Wirral Show, Wirral Coastal Walk, Multi cultural centre and Mosque Liverpool, Southport and CCO open day

• In the 13 days we have had 1,815 contacts• Bid to National Cancer Action Team has been

successful for MCCN own Health Vehicle for 15 month project

Early Detection and Prevention Strategy

The main aim of the Health Vehicle is to support the MCCN Early Detection and Prevention Strategy in following ways:

• Health Promotion Lifestyle choices• Raise awareness of key cancer symptoms• Practical advice and support• Appropriate signposting to other services• Improving accessibility for all

groups/communities
